Charles is a village and former civil parish, now in the parish of Brayford, in the North Devon district of Devon, England. Its nearest town is South Molton, which lies approximately 4.7 miles (7.6 km) south-east from the hamlet, just off the A399 road. In 1961 the parish had a population of 203.[1] On 1 April 1986 the parish was abolished and merged with Brayford.[2]
